'Scrubs' Stars Address Surprising Offscreen Split in Revival
The revival of Scrubs has surprised fans with unexpected changes, including separating main characters J.D. and Elliot. The premiere aired on February 25 with a fresh twist.
Reactions from the Cast
John C. McGinley, who portrays Dr. Cox, praised Bill Lawrence's strong comeback with the new season, describing it as a success and filled with surprises. Judy Reyes shared her views on the ongoing collaboration between Bill Lawrence and Zach Braff, noting their talent contributed to the show's success.
Set in a New Era
The original series aired from 2001 to 2010 and followed staff at Sacred Heart Hospital. The show returned for a ninth season under the title "Med School." Despite changes, core cast members like Braff and Faison returned along with newcomers Ava Bunn, Jacob Dudman, and others.
Evolution of Characters
Judy Reyes talked about the characters' growth over time, emphasizing how they are influenced by aging and experience. She expressed pride in maintaining character development and continuity in storytelling.
The Scrubs revival continues to explore new dynamics while staying true to its roots. Scrubs airs on ABC Wednesdays at 8 p.m. ET.
